    Abstract: Embodiments of the present invention include method, systems and computer program products for algebraic phasing of polyploids. Aspects of the invention include receiving a matrix including a set of two or more single-nucleotide poloymorphisms (SNPs) for two or more sample organisms. Each row of the matrix is set to a ploidy based on a number of ploidies present in the two or more sample organisms. Each allele in the set of two or more SNPs is represented as a binary number. A set of algebraic rules is received, wherein the set of algebraic rules include an algebraic phasing algorithm. And the set of algebraic rules are applied to the matrix to determine a haplotype of a parent of the two or more sample organisms.

    Abstract: A system comprises a plurality of fans, wherein each of the fans is configurable to run at a unique fan speed that is different from fan speeds of other fans from the plurality of fans. A plurality of variable-positioned devices, capable of being positioned at various locations within the system, are physically positioned such that airflow from one of the plurality of fans strikes a particular variable-positioned device. A plurality of anemometers, each of which is connected to a particular variable-positioned device, measure airflow across the variable-positioned devices. A system controller, which contains location information that identifies a physical position within the system of each of the plurality of fans, utilizes airflow readings from each of the anemometers to identify a physical location of each of the plurality of variable-positioned devices by matching physical locations of the fans to measured airflow across the variable-positioned devices.

    Abstract: To provide a more cost effective way to manage the infrastructure while addressing the security needs of a computerized data center, a technique for credential and protocol independent management of infrastructure in a computerized data processing system is provided. More cost effective and secure management is obtained through modified workflows used in the operational management of the computer data processing system. A workflow is first parsed to locate device specific operation requests. Such specifications are then replaced with logical equivalents. The resulting workflow is neutral with respect to both credentials and protocol. Prior to execution, the modified workflow is combined with information retrieved from a resource or by an administrator that further resolves the workflow to a specific target object or plurality of target objects. Security is enhanced through granular administration of user ID and password combinations which may be maintained separate from the workflows in which they are used.

    Abstract: The leakage current on a semiconductor is reduced while the semiconductor is in a sleep mode. This is accomplished by (1) placing the semiconductor in the sleep mode; (2) providing the semiconductor an internal supply voltage derived from an external supply voltage applied to the semiconductor chip (where the internal supply voltage is less in quantity than the external supply voltage); and (3) reducing the internal supply voltage when the semiconductor enters the sleep mode from an activated mode and returning the internal supply voltage to an activated mode level when the semiconductor returns to the activated mode. The reducing step includes supplying the external supply voltage to a reference circuit which outputs therefrom a reference voltage; and supplying the reference voltage to a regulator, where the regulator attempts to match the reference voltage and outputs therefrom the internal supply voltage.

    Abstract: Servo pattern bursts are recorded with two frequencies that are detected using heterodyne detection with oscillators at the same frequency as the respective recorded frequencies. The two frequencies are selected to be orthogonal so the sensed servo pattern of one frequency is zero when detected with the detecting circuitry of the other frequency. The servo pattern bursts of the two frequencies are placed close together on the disk so they are sensed simultaneously so that, with orthogonality processing, a PES signal from a three phase pattern is sufficient to provide a robust linear signal, thereby eliminating one of the bursts from a quadrature pattern and reducing the disk surface area needed in each track for the servo pattern by 25% or more.
